The king gave him a reward.

A. He was given by the king a reward.

B. He was given a reward by the king.

C. He were given a reward by the king.

D. A reward was given by him to the king.

Answer: Option B

Solution(By Examveda Team)

He was given a reward by the king.

Given sentence is in Past simple tense and it is in active voice, we need to change it into passive voice.

Rule :
Subject + (was / were) + V3 + Optional Agents.
